Remove/highlight photoshop menu items to speed up workflow
#1

This is a great tip from Petapixel - you can edit your menus in photoshop to achieve one of two things. Firstly, you can remove menu items that you don't use to speed photoshop, and secondly you can colourise the items which you use often or are important to you, so that you can find them easier.
